1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is classification?
Back
Classification is the process of grouping objects based on their properties.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does it mean if something is smooth?
Back
Smooth means that you can easily slide your hand over it without feeling bumps.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does it mean if something is rough?
Back
Rough means that it has bumps or irregularities that make it feel uneven.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an example of a smooth object?
Back
A glass surface is an example of a smooth object.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an example of a rough object?
Back
A sandpaper is an example of a rough object.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How can we classify materials?
Back
We can classify materials by their size, color, texture, or hardness.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does it mean if something is hard?
Back
Hard means that it does not bend or break easily.
